Green measures pay off
9:44am Monday 21st April 2008
AN ANNUAL investment of £100,000 in Newport council's energy efficiency programme has paid off with an overall reduction of 3.7 per cent in carbon emissions from its own buildings, corporate director Graham Bingham told the cabinet.

National recognition
9:01am Friday 18th April 2008
NATIONAL RECOGNITION: The fantastic Newport Wetlands Reserve at Nash has been given the highest possible accolade by being officially designated as a National Nature Reserve.
